SCCM Agent Dağıtma İşlemleri ve Configuration Manager, Software Center Uygulamalarını İnceleme
Merhaba ,
Bu makalemizde System Center Configuration Manager ürününde kurulumdan sonra yapılması gereken client’lara Sccm Agent (Ajan) Dağıtma işlemlerinden bahsedeceğiz . Ayrıca Configuration Manager ve Software Center Uygulamalarını detaylı inceleyeceğiz.
Client’lara SCCM Agent Dağıtmanın birden çok yöntemi mevcuttur;
- Manuel Kurulum
- Automatic Deployment
Bu yöntemlerden en çok kullanılanlardan “Automatic Deployment” yöntemini anlatacağım.
Automatic Deployment methodunda yükleme işlemlerine başlamak için ilk öncelik olarak ;
- Sccm Console ekranından “Administration” seçeneğini seçeriz. Administration seçeneğini seçtikten sonra Site yapılandırma seçeneğine girerek PS1 site’ımızın üzerine sağ tıklayarak “Client Installation Settings “ seçeğinden “Client Push Installation” seçeriz.
2. “Enable automatic site-wide client push installation ” seçeneğini seçerek ; client domaine Join (Üye) olur olmaz tüm bilgisayalara kurulum gerçekleşmeye başlar.Configuration Manager kurulumlarını “Servers, workstation ve sistem serverler’larına” kurmak için ilgili seçenekleri seçeriz. “Always install the Configuration Manager client on Domain Controller” seçeneğini seçerek işlemlere devam ederiz.
3. “Accounts” seçeneğini seçeriz. Ardından “sarı” simgeye tıklarız. Burada Yeni hesap oluşturmamız gerekecektir. Nedeni; Domain Admin ayrıcalığına sahip bir hesap tanımlamamız gerekmektedir. Bu hesap Client’larda agent kurulumu sağlamak için kullanılacaktır. Bu yüzden burada hesap oluşturuz. “New Account” seçeneğini seçeriz.
4. Sccm Admin kullanıcı hesabımızın Domain Admin grubunun üyesi olduğundan dolayı onu kullanmamız gerekmektedir. Şifreyi doğru halde gireriz. Şifreyi yanlış girersek; agent’lar client’ların hiç birine kurulumu gerçekleşmeyecektir.
5. Oluşturmuş olduğumuz kullanıcı hesabının eklendiğini gördük. “Apply” seçeneğini seçerek ardından “OK” seçeneğini seçeriz.
6. “Assets and Compliance “ bölümünü seçerek “Devices” ekranına gideriz. Cihazlara agent kurulumu sağlamak için sağ tıklayarak “Install Client” seçeneğini seçeriz.
7. Seçeneği seçtikten sonra ; “Next” seçeneği seçeriz .
8. “Next” Seçeneğini seçerek devam ederiz.
9. “Next” seçeneğini seçeriz.
10. “Close” seçeneğini seçeriz.
Bu işlemleri yaptığım anda kurulum dosyaları hedef cihazlara kopyalanıp ardından kurulum yapacaktır.
Yapımızda bulunan Windows 10 işletim sistemli cihaza gidelim ; dosya gezgininden ilgili dosya yoluna gideriz. “Ccmsetup” altında “ccm” sistem dosyalarının kopyalandığını görmüş olduktan sonra kurulum loglarını görebilmemiz için “CM Trace” Tool’unu kurulum yaparak; bu dosyayı o halde real-time log şeklinde izleyebiliriz.
Ccmsetup Log dosyasını incelediğimizde client kurulumu için dosyaların indirildiğini ve kopyalandığını görüyoruz.
Kurulumu ayrıca Task Manager (görev yöneticisi) ekranından izleyebiliriz. Bunun için görev çubuğuna tıklayıp “Task Manager” seçeneğini seçmemiz yeterlidir.
Seçeneği seçtikten sonra Task Manager ekranında “Details” seçeneği seçerek ccmsetup.exe’nin çalıştığını görmekteyiz. Bu işlemin tamamlanması bir kaç dakika sürebilir ve ardından exec adlı hizmet oluşacaktır. istemci kurulduğu sürece bu hizmet çalışmaya devam edecektir. Kurulumun tamamlanması en az 10 dakika sürmektedir.
Ve sonra Windows klasörüne geri dönüp iki klasörün oluştuğunuda görmekteyiz.
“Ccm” her cihazın local içerik indirme klasörüdür. “ccmcache” klasörü ise ; temelde tüm envanter verilerini toplamak içindir. “ccm” Klasöründen “Logs” klasörüne girerek; “ClientDManagerStartup” Dosyasını açarız. Bu log dosyası bir client’ın düzgün bir şekilde veri alıp almadığını ve Uyku süresinin ne kadar olduğunu göstermektedir. Sonrasında kendini sccm Sunucusunu kaydettirecektir.
Bu arada “Task Manager” kısmında “Details” ve “Services” seçeneklerinde “CcmExec” adında hizmet çalışıyor olacaktır.
Sonrasında kurulum tamamlandığında windows “control panel” ekranına gideriz ; control panelini sağ üst tarafta bulunan “small icons” seçeneğini seçerek Configuration Manager uygulmasının yüklü olduğunuz görürüz.
Burada client’ımıza atanmış olan bilgileri incelemek istersek ;
“Assigned Management Point” seçeneği ; “Management Point” ile görüşerek , sccm server ve istemci arasında köprü görevi görmektedir.
“Client Certificate” bölümü ; management point , client sertifikasıyla konuşuyor. Bu sertifika türü kendinden imzalı sertifika türü olarak geçmektedir. Site Code bilgim “PS1” olarak görünmektedir.
Components’ler kısmına tıkladığımızda burada da aynı şekilde ; tüm componentlerin yüklendiğini görüyoruz. (Harware ınventory agent , Compliance and settings management, remote tool agent, software distribution agent vb. Bileşenlerin yüklendiğini görüyoruz.
“Actions” seçeneği seçtiğimizde ; burada görünen işlemlerden birini buradan çalıştırmak istersek ; ilgili eylem seçilir ve “Run now” seçeneği seçerek , seçtiğimiz görev ne olursa olsun o görevi tetikleyerek politikaların ve işlemlerin gerçekleşmesini sağlarız.
“Site” seçeneğinden site’larımızı görebiliriz.
“Network” seçeneğini seçtiğimizde ; şuanda ortamımızda internet tabanlı management point bulunmadığı için boş gelmektedir.
Sonrasında “cache” seçeneğini tıkladığımızda “Configration Settings” seçeneğini seçerek ;
Burada cache’lerin nereye download edileceğini belirten path yazmaktadır. Şuanda 5GB boyutu mevcuttur. Bu boyutu istediğimiz miktarda konfigure edebiliriz.
Sccm tüm client makinelerinde client loglarının tümünü “Logs” klasörü içerisinde tutumaktadır.
Bunun yanında control edeceğim farklı bir programda var oda “Software Center” olarak geçmektedir. Windows seçeneği seçerek arama kutucuğundan “Software Center” programını seçerek çift tıklarız.
çift tıkladıktan sonra software center programının açıldığını gördük. “Software Center” cihaz tabanlı uygulama mağazası olarak geçmektedir. Sccm Sunucusundan yayınlamış olduğumuz uygulamalar ve güncellemeler ne olursa olsun burada bulunabilir.
Seçenekleri açıklamak gerekirse ;
- “Application” seçeneği ; sccm sunucusu üzerinden dağıttığımız uygulamalar burada görünecektir.
- “Updates”: sccm tarafından dağıttığımız update’ler burada görünecektir.
- “Operating Systems” ; sccm üzeriden göndermiş olduğumuz işletim sistemi kurulumlarını buradan takip ederiz.
- “Installation Status” ; kurulum yapılanların görüntülerini buradan takip edebiliriz.
- “Device Compliance” ; cihazımızın uyumlu olup olmadığını buradan izleyebiliriz
6. “Options” seçeneğinde ise ; Organizasyonumuzun çalışma saatlerini istediğimiz gibi belirleyebiliriz.
7. Tekrardan sccm console ekranına giderek “Devices” seçeneğini seçerek “Refresh “ işlemini yaparak client’larımızın yükleme durumlarınının tamamlandığını görmüş oluruz.
Makalemi zaman ayırıp okuduğunuz için çok teşekkür ederim. Diğer makalelerimde görüşmek üzere
Faydalı olması Dileğiyle…
Eline sağlık, SCCM konusunda güzel kaynaklar oluşturuyorsun.
Teşekkür ederim Hakan Hocam.
Teşekkürler, eline sağlık hocam.
Server 2016 ve 2019 Sürümler için Collection oluşturmama rağmen çalışmadı, ikisinde de hem 2016 hem de 2019 sürümleri listelenmekte. Bu sorunumu ararken kendimi burada buldum 🙂 , belki ilgili konu başlığına dair makalenizi yayımlamadan bilginiz var ise paylaşırsın 🙂
İyi çalışmalar dilerim,
Merhaba Onur Bey,
Geri dönüşünüz için çok teşekkür ederim. Umarım Faydalı olmuştur. İlgili Client Push Assign işlemi Collection bazında yapılması mümkün değildir. Sccm Agent Kurulumu Organizasyonunuzda Domaine Üye olan Bilgisayarlar, Sunucular için sccm tarafından hiçbir işleminize gerek kalmadan kurulumlar otomatik gerçekleşmektedir.
Bahsettiğiniz konu başka bir konu olabilir. Forumumuz da sorunu açık şekilde dile getirirseniz. Memnuniyetle yardımcı olmaya çalışıyor oluruz.
Saygılarımla.